Gameplay Changes - Followers:
Overhauled follower and leadership system
Followers can now be controlled using a radial menu, replacing the previous right-click 'move aside' behavior.
Options include:
Wait/Follow (novice) - Allies will either stay in place (within a 5x5 area of their location when told to stop) or follow the player. If told to stop in a smaller room like 3x2 they will stay within the confines of that room.
Drop Equipment (skilled) - Allies surrender some or all od their equipment, depending on the leadership skill of the player. Dropped equipment via this method are counted as 'player-owned' and allies will have the existing 5 second delay in re-picking up player items.
Toggle Class (skilled) - Selecting this will toggle an ally's "class", current options are "mixed", "melee" and "ranged". Upon recruitment allies start as mixed class, and if that creature is of the type to auto-pick up items on the ground (humans, automatons, goblins, goatmen) it will pick up anything as before.
"Ranged" classes will only auto-pick up crossbows, shortbows, slings for weapons (excludes magicstaffs) and only some of the lighter armor variants. (E.g Steel/Crystal breastpieces/helms/shields are excluded) "Melee" classes will skip over ranged weapons and stack on all gear they find.
Item Pickup (basic) - Toggles between "all", "unowned" and "none", and upon recruitment defaults to "unowned". Selecting "none" makes sure allies do not replace their equipment with any loot, and "unowned" will only pick up items that were not dropped by a player. "All" will pick up all items, and retain the 5 second delay for player-owned items.
Move To (basic) - Selecting this allows you to specify a point for your ally to move towards in the world. Upon reaching the destination (if pathable), allies shift their stance into "wait" rather than follow and wait for further movement instruction. Allies are receptive to their surroundings during this state, and will engage in combat if any enemies are along the way. It is possible to pull an ally out of combat using this command as long as they can escape their attacker without being hit. Targeting a point to move uses the up/down look axis (a first in the Barony world!), so you can point to which exact tile on the map (or minimap) where to go. Alternatively pointing at a wall with have your ally path to the tile in front of the wall. After reaching a destination, allies will do a quick scan in the area to check for enemies.
Attack/Interact - As with "Move To", selecting this activates a targeting cursor. The difference is this will target entities rather than tiles in the world. Depending on the type of entity hovered over, a prompt for "attack" or "interact" will appear.
Attacking (expert) - Selecting a monster in the world will force your ally to target the selected monster, provided it is an enemy. It is also said that with enough persuasion, ANY monster can be an enemy! If the player is too inexperienced in Leadership, "Attack" as a command will not be available, and will indicate as non interactable when selecting any creature.
Interacting (basic) - Certain types of entities are set as interactable depending on the creature type of your follower.
If a monster can wield items (generally humanoids), then selecting an item will force equip the item onto your ally. Monsters will never unequip items given to them in this fashion. Auto equipping new items will only reoccur when the forced item has broken. Cursed items on the ally can not be swapped out. Rings and amulets can also be equipped using this command - but are hard to remove!
Certain allies (fleshy, non-otherworldly beings) can eat food if interacted with to provide a small heal + temporary bonus to HP regen if high quality. The better the food, the greater the heal + regen effects.
Allies have a decreasing hunger meter like players do, however there are no side effects to under or over-satiation. The creature will refuse food if over-satiated. Healing via food has a chance to raise leadership skill. Humans can have a hard time handling spoiled food, but the other creatures in the dungeons seem to handle a bit of mould a-ok.
And finally, a select few allies can interact with a couple "world" entities. This includes humans, goblins, automatons, goatmen, kobolds and gnomes. Currently this is limited to removing torches off the walls and flipping levers.
Rest (skilled) - Your ally falls asleep and has increased HP regen for 30-60 seconds. Usable once per floor, for each ally.
Options on the wheel are locked out based on their required "skill level". The player's effective skill level is Charisma + Leadership proficiency (0 to 100, named proficiency tiers above novice have 20 points difference).
Options are also locked out depending on the "rank" of the monster. Humans are basic creatures and so their requirements are as per the base levels above. Each rank above 1 typically increases the skill requirements by 20 points.

Other Follower Changes:
Number of allowed followers to recruit via interacting has been rescaled. Formula is now max 4 followers below EXPERT proficiency, then +2 for each rank (EXPERT, MASTER). Legendary Leadership grants follower cap of 25. (Previously was 1 follower per 4 Leadership, to a max of 25.)
Followers now are granted some XP when their leader kills something. (Previously no XP was awarded, only followers that killed monsters would gain XP)
Followers now have a chance to block during combat, influenced by their Shield proficiency and the leader's Leadership proficiency.
Followers that would retreat on low health now do not retreat if the leader's combined Charisma and Leadership proficiency is greater than EXPERT (60)
Human spawn LVL is now scaled depending on tileset. Each tileset past the mines increases their LVL by 3 + random 0 to 3. (E.g swamp is 6-9, Labyrinth is 9-12). Followers are not affected by this scaling, only random spawns.
Added reduced human spawns in the later tilesets instead of all automatons for ally options (caves/citadel).
Added followers to the right-hand side party sheet to show their HP and LVL (previously only other players were shown). If the list of followers is too long then the remaining entries are scrollable.

Gameplay Changes - Continued
Added new item - "Magicstaff of Charm Monster", appears in random generation similar to fire and lightning magicstaffs.
On hit has a chance to charm a monster into becoming a permanent follower. If charming fails, then it will inflict a "pacify" status effect.
Has a base chance of 80% to inflict Charm. Monsters of higher "rank" (detailed in the follower section of the changelog) will have reduced chance to be charmed, 30% per rank past the lowest. Has no effect on bosses, shadows or cockatrices.
Successfully charming a monster increases the caster's Leadership proficiency.
"Pacify" status effect temporarily causes a monster to forcibly retreat and lose it's ability to attack.
Charm chance is increased by the caster's Charisma and Leadership proficiency.
Charm chance is increased if the target is under the 'drunk' or 'confused' status effects.
Charm chance is increased if the target is not engaged in combat.
Shopkeepers are immune to charm, however can be pacified and will reset any grudges for players in the game.
Monsters dominated or charmed will stop being attacked by other new-found allies and also reset their aggro.
Succubus and Incubus can now cast 'Charm Monster' to recruit allies. Killing a succubus has a chance to drop a magicstaff of charm monster.
Poison status effect damage is now increased with the target's max HP pool, roughly 1 additional damage per 20 HP. Previously was a constant 3 HP damage tick.
Bleed status effect damage is now increased with the target's max HP pool, roughly 1 additional damage per 30 HP. Previously was a constant 1 HP damage tick. Effect damage is reduced by 1 HP per 5 Constitution. Bleed ending early HP is now 5 + Constitution. Previously always stopped at 5 HP remaining if the effect was still active.

Workshop:
Added configurable light/sound/player message source sprites to the editor that trigger when powered for custom maps and story.
Light source radius/brightness can be set for ambient lighting or dance parties.
Sound source refers to any line in the sounds/sounds.txt file to play at location or globally to mimic voice lines.
Text source sends a message to all players that can be exposition or dialogue.
Added 'signal timer' sprite that takes power input from 1 side and outputs on the opposite site. Works like a delay or a clock so the output can be set to toggle on/off every few seconds to create a light show or can be delayed to time custom player messages.
maps/levels.txt files can now include optional tags to determine minotaur spawns, dark maps and secret level spawn chance.
Applies only to "gen:" prefixed lines.
E.g "gen:swamp secret%: 50 minotaur%: 25 darkmap%: 10" in 1 line spawns a secret 50% of the time, minotaur 25% of the time and 10% dark map chance for the swamp.
All tags are optional, so "gen:ruins secret%: 100 minotaur%: 10" will generate a ruins dark map using normal random generation.
Simply leaving a line as "gen:ruins" uses the normal random generation for all tags. Modifying this list counts as modding the map list and will disable Steam Achievements.
Custom secret level exits can now be added, if your map name is "castle" and you generate a layout with "gen:castle", the engine will look for a secret map "castlesecret.lmp" to spawn as the secret level exit.
Music and tiles are now properly working and ready for Workshop.
Added support for custom music in maps that did not have unique music tracks:
These maps are gnomishmines.lmp, greatcastle.lmp, sokoban.lmp, caveslair.lmp, bramscastle.lmp, hamlet.lmp
To add custom music, add gnomishmines.ogg, greatcastle.ogg etc as files inside the /music/ folder of a mod or the base game directory.
Added items_global.txt to compatible Workshop files.
Added function in init.cpp source code to create executables that auto load your mod assets on startup to help creators distribute their mod. (gamemodsWorkshopPreloadMod(Steam Workshop File ID))
Added 'disable opening' editor map flag to disable the use of opening and locking spells.

V3.1.6 Workshop Changelog
Added models to workshop support to replace existing assets. To add models to a mod file, place the new file into the blank /mods/YOUR_MOD/models/ directory where appropriate (monsters go in models/creatures, boulders go in models/decoration etc). Keep the name the same as the original you are replacing and it'll be overwritten when you start modded game.
You can replace the filenames the game looks for in the mods/YOUR_MOD/models/models.txt file, however this is not cross compatible with other mods modifying the model files, so bear that in mind.
Added books to workshop support. To add books to a mod file, place the new YOURBOOK.txt file into the blank /mods/YOUR_MOD/books/ directory. Each .txt file in this books directory will extend the amount of books present in the game and will automatically generate naturally in the world. Inside the .txt file just needs to be the text of your book.
Added sounds/music to workshop support. To add these to a mod file, place new files in the mods/YOUR_MOD/sound or mods/YOUR_MOD/music directory. Format must be .ogg files. For sounds - the same as models, you can choose to change the mods/YOUR_MOD/sound/sounds.txt file to change the filenames being looked for but is not cross compatible with other mods.
Music filenames are fixed so you can only replace the filenames seen in the normal music folder.
Added tiles (walls/ground textures etc) to workshop support. To add these to a mod file, place new files in the mods/YOUR_MOD/images/tiles/ folder. Modifying these essentially is a texture pack!

Proficiencies/Stats:
Reworked Sneak proficiency capstone:
Now only provides invisibility if sneaking with no off-hand held item.
Quadruples backstab and doubles flanking bonus damage output.
Invisibility is broken temporarily when attacking or casting spells.
Rebalanced spellcasting capstone, Player now learns the Forcebolt spell with 0 mana cost instead of Magic Missile.
CON now decreases the duration of Sleep status effect.
Items:
Added auto-stacking of items when picked up or successfully appraising them.
Implemented Artifact tier armor.
All equipment that grants stat bonuses now take into account the blessing. E.g +2 glasses now provide +3 PER instead of always +1 PER.
Scrolls of Remove curse and Identify now open up a GUI for the player to select an item.
Spellbooks now deteriorate by 1 use after learning the spell from it.
Added/Implemented Blindfold of Telepathy and Blindfold of Focus. Blindfolds now apply a lingering blind effect for a short duration when unequipped.
Crystal tier weapon damage increased from 7 to 10 base attack.
Adjusted item stacking behavior, now items such as armor, weapons and magicstaffs no longer stack. Consumables such as thrown items, gems, food etc will stack.
Blocking with a light source (torch, latern) now lights up the area even more for the player.
Mirror shield now requires facing the incoming magic projectile when blocking in order to reflect spells.
Rebalanced fountain enchantments, now will enchant only 1 piece of equipment usually, and has a rare chance to enchant all worn equipment as it did before.
Added negative effects for cursed potions.
Thrown blessed potions of water now deals additional damage to the undead.
Potions of Healing and Extrahealing now grant bonus healing depending on the CON stat. Bonus is 2x and 4x CON respectively.
Slightly reduced healing rate from sources of HP regeneration. Healing rate is now improved with blessing.
